NI: Road traffic offence prisoners watch car crash demo at Magilligan

Prisoners who were involved in road traffic offences watched a road traffic collision demonstration as part of a series of events to mark Road Safety Week.

Over 65 prisoners took part in an education programme put in place by agreement between Magilligan Prison and Northern Ireland Fire and Rescue Service.

The PSNI and Coastal Care private ambulance service also took part in the demo.

Road Safety Week aims to encourage organisations and communities to take action on road safety.

Magilligan Prison Governor Richard Taylor said: “Road safety is a community issue. Dangers such as fast drivers blight communities and, during Road Safety Week, I can think of no better place to highlight the consequences than in a prison where some people will end up as a result of their actions while driving.

“By supporting safer driving and promoting life-saving messages, we are playing our part in building a safer community by supporting and challenging those in our care to change and helping to reduce re-offending.”
